Hydraulic Honing Tube is a steel tube with high-precision inner hole and excellent surface quality. It is mainly used as a cylinder in hydraulic systems and pneumatic equipment. It uses special processing technology to ensure the roughness, dimensional accuracy and wear resistance of the inner wall, which can effectively improve the performance and service life of hydraulic equipment.

Production process
The production of hydraulic honing tube mainly includes the following steps:
Pipe selection
Cold-drawn seamless steel pipe is used as raw material to ensure that the steel pipe has high strength and toughness.
Rough machining
The steel pipe is preliminarily turned by mechanical machining to remove the oxide layer, defects and part of the excess on the surface.
Honing process
Honing is the core process of hydraulic honing tube. Use high-precision honing tools to fine-process the inner hole of the steel pipe, and remove the remaining trace material on the inner wall through grinding to achieve the ideal size and finish.
Inspection and heat treatment
After honing, strict size, surface roughness and hardness testing are carried out. If necessary, heat treatment is required to improve the comprehensive mechanical properties and fatigue resistance of the steel pipe.
Surface treatment
To prevent corrosion and oxidation, the inner and outer surfaces of hydraulic honing tubes can be treated with anti-rust treatment, such as oiling or electroplating.

Common materials for hydraulic honing tubes include carbon steel and alloy steel to meet the needs of different application scenarios. The following are some common steel grades:
Carbon steel: such as 20#, 45#, with good processability and toughness, suitable for ordinary hydraulic systems.
Alloy steel: such as 40Cr, 42CrMo, with higher strength and wear resistance, suitable for high pressure and heavy load systems.
Stainless steel: such as 304, 316L, used in special occasions with corrosion resistance requirements.

The production and inspection of hydraulic honing tubes must comply with relevant standards in different countries and regions, including:
China: GB/T 8713 (Technical conditions for hydraulic and pneumatic precision inner diameter seamless steel tubes)
USA: ASTM A519 (Seamless carbon steel and alloy steel mechanical tubes)
Europe: EN 10305-1 (Technical conditions for cold-drawn seamless precision steel tubes)
Japan: JIS G3445 (Carbon steel tubes for mechanical structures)
These standards have clear requirements in terms of dimensional tolerances, inner surface roughness, straightness and mechanical properties.

Hydraulic honing tubes are widely used in:
Hydraulic cylinders and cylinders
As the inner wall material of hydraulic cylinders and cylinders, it ensures sealing, wear resistance and smooth operation.
Lifting equipment and construction machinery
Used in the manufacture of hydraulic arms and telescopic rods to withstand high-intensity working conditions.
Automobile and shipbuilding industry
Applied to the oil cylinders, brake cylinders and transmission systems of hydraulic systems to improve equipment performance and reliability.
Aerospace and military industry
Used in high-precision hydraulic and pneumatic systems to meet working requirements under extreme conditions.
